- Ukrainian Intel Warns of Russian Campaign to Target Frontline Civilian Logistics
Ukraine’s Military Intelligence (HUR) reported that Russia’s Rubikon drone unit is targeting civilian gas stations, trucks, buses, and cars in frontline regions. HUR also accused Russian special services of conducting false-flag attacks by striking their own civilians.
- SBU Claims Bryansk Bus Strike Was Russian False Flag Operation
The SBU claims to have obtained a Russian internal document indicating no Ukrainian drones were present during a strike on a Belarusian youth football team bus in Russia’s Bryansk region. The agency suggests the attack may have been orchestrated by Russian special services as a false flag operation.
- Ukraine Thwarts Russian-Backed FPV Drone Assassination Plot to Kill Senior HUR Official
Ukrainian law enforcement agencies prevented a Russian-backed plot to assassinate HUR representative Yusov using an FPV drone. A suspect recruited by Russian special services was detained after gathering surveillance data on the target in exchange for up to $100,000.
